macojoe 02-15-2013 05:27 PM

Easy!! Up here we just use a squid jig, get into the school anmd drop in then jig up hard till you snag them, thats it!
There are a few people I know that bait them with small shiners or other stuff but in the run you need nothing.
Its a messy job they spray water ink and crap all over the place, I use throw away clothes when I go!!

these are some homemade jigs and an old fly rod i rigged up. we ride around the marina and look under the lights until we see them, then toss the jigs in and dance it around. some times they are very aggressive and attack it, other times very timid and barely swip at it. when they impale themselves on the barbless hooks you just lift them up and plop in a bucket. if you stop lifting while in the water, they get off. one of the best rigs to use is a bream buster pole. lotta fun
